Condividi tramite


Funzione KsFilterAddTopologyConnections (ks.h)

La funzione KsFilterAddTopologyConnections aggiunge nuove connessioni di topologia a un filtro.

Sintassi

KSDDKAPI NTSTATUS KsFilterAddTopologyConnections(
  [in] PKSFILTER                           Filter,
  [in] ULONG                               NewConnectionsCount,
  [in] const KSTOPOLOGY_CONNECTION * const NewTopologyConnections
);

Parametri

[in] Filter

Un puntatore al KSFILTER a cui aggiungere le nuove connessioni.

[in] NewConnectionsCount

Numero di connessioni in NewTopologyConnections.

[in] NewTopologyConnections

Puntatore a una matrice di strutture KSTOPOLOGY_CONNECTION contenenti le nuove connessioni di topologia.

Valore restituito

KsFilterAddTopologyConnections restituisce STATUS_SUCCESS o un codice di errore che indica l'errore del tentativo di aggiungere connessioni della topologia.

Osservazioni

Si noti che il mutex del controllo filtro deve essere mantenuto prima di chiamare questa funzione.

Per altre informazioni sui mutex, vedere Mutexes in AVStream.

Fabbisogno

Requisito Valore
client minimo supportato Disponibile in Microsoft Windows XP e nei sistemi operativi successivi e in DirectX 8.0 e versioni successive di DirectX.
piattaforma di destinazione Universale
intestazione ks.h (include Ks.h)
libreria Ks.lib
IRQL PASSIVE_LEVEL

Vedere anche

KSFILTER

KSTOPOLOGY_CONNECTION